E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
DFA敏感词过滤
词法分析
标识符的转移图转移图标识符转移图.png关键字表(哈希表的构造)正则表达式(ε空集,c为所有ε的子集)选择M|N连接MN(kleene)闭包M*正则表达式语法糖有限状态自动机FA有限状态自动机.png确定的有限状态自动机详细图
DFA
椰树上的一只猫
·
2020-06-23 05:39
敏感词过滤
packagecn.td.we.filter;importjavax.servlet.*;importjavax.servlet.annotation.WebFilter;importjava.io.*;importjava.lang.reflect.InvocationHandler;importjava.lang.reflect.Method;importjava.lang.reflect.P
taodanc
·
2020-06-23 05:35
JAVA
Java实现
敏感词过滤
敏感词、文字过滤是一个网站必不可少的功能,如何设计一个好的、高效的过滤算法是非常有必要的。前段时间我一个朋友(马上毕业,接触编程不久)要我帮他看一个文字过滤的东西,它说检索效率非常慢。我把它程序拿过来一看,整个过程如下:读取敏感词库、如果HashSet集合中,获取页面上传文字,然后进行匹配。我就想这个过程肯定是非常慢的。对于他这个没有接触的人来说我想也只能想到这个,更高级点就是正则表达式。但是非常
chenssy
·
2020-06-22 22:01
编译原理中正则表达式直接构造
DFA
,
DFA
的最小化算法
之前提到了经过通过NFA来构造
DFA
(http://blog.csdn.net/betabin/article/details/8057787),现在继续来忽悠下,直接从正则表达式构造
DFA
。
flyear_cn
·
2020-06-22 21:11
编译原理
形式语言与编译七 词法分析
词法分析3型文法与我们前面讲的正则表达式、自动机家族(
DFA
、NFA、e-NFA)都是等价的。
_Sandman
·
2020-06-22 16:00
NFA到
DFA
的子集构造法
blog.csdn.net/qq_23100787/article/details/50402643整体的步骤是三步:一,先把正规式转换为NFA(非确定有穷自动机),二,在把NFA通过“子集构造法”转化为
DFA
可欣の扣得儿
·
2020-06-22 15:29
编译原理
编译原理c++实现词法分析器
题目要求根据设计的
DFA
完成手工词法分析器的c++实现测试样例共有四组测试样例,要求格式完全一致。
skystoler
·
2020-06-22 15:27
c++
编译原理
词法分析器
编译原理c++基于LR分析表编写语法分析器
//通过构造项目集规范族完成识别可归前缀的
DFA
。(2)根据测试样例及你建立的LR分析表,用c++完成语法分析器的设计。测试样例要求格式完全一致,第一行为输入,第二行为要求的输出,共四组样例。
skystoler
·
2020-06-22 15:27
mysql授权、删除用户和角色权限
*TO'backup'@'172.16.0.157'IDENTIFIEDBYPASSWORD'*38B4F16EADB1601E713D9F03F1
DFA
1F71C624A91';#GRANTUSAGEON
aoying5106
·
2020-06-22 14:48
NFA转
DFA
【编译原理】
NFA转
DFA
的算法在编译原理的课本上有,当时看了好多遍都不懂。现在我通俗的说一下究竟是怎么转化。用一个例子来说明怎么实现NFA转
DFA
与
DFA
简化。
aaaaawyf
·
2020-06-22 11:51
编译原理
PHP 实现
敏感词过滤
(附敏感词库)
在实现
敏感词过滤
的算法中,我们必须要减少运算,而
DFA
在
DFA
算法中几乎没有什么计算,有的只是状态的转换。所以想更高效的进行敏感词的过滤,需要使用
DFA
算法。
哈哈,名字可以改
·
2020-06-22 11:58
python re 模块小结
windows764位,python2.7re是什么:regularexpression缩写,意为正则表达式,是python的众多模块之一re用途:从文本中有选择的批量抽取想要的文本碎片re类型:分为
DFA
a15539181818
·
2020-06-22 10:15
Python
敏感词过滤
的实现
一个简单的实现classNaiveFilter():'''FilterMessagesfromkeywordsverysimplefilterimplementation>>>f=NaiveFilter()>>>f.add("sexy")>>>f.filter("hellosexybaby")hello****baby'''def__init__(self):self.keywords=set([
肉尼
·
2020-06-22 08:12
关键字查找
中文关键字查找(
敏感词过滤
)背景近来需要在极短的时间来查找某一段文字是否出现关键字(敏感字)的应用。网上找了一些资料,有用java写的双数组AC树,达到每秒27Mb的速度。
W_SX12553
·
2020-06-22 07:01
算法
精通正则表达式六:匹配优先与忽略优先
要注意的是,
DFA
不支持忽略优先。实例来看下面两个例子:匹配优先:忽略优先:原因是什么呢?
里昂_leon
·
2020-06-22 05:37
正则表达式
精通正则表达式五:NFA与
DFA
定义NFA与
DFA
是正则表达式引擎所使用的两种基本技术:NFA:非确定型有穷自动机
DFA
:确定型有穷自动机作者用用电动机来比喻
DFA
,用汽油机来比喻NFA,他们确实有许多相似之处:1.汽油机的历史更长,
里昂_leon
·
2020-06-22 05:06
正则表达式
小程序调用百度ai 文本内容审核 实现
敏感词过滤
百度智能云API接入指南https://ai.baidu.com/ai-doc/REFERENCE/Ck3dwjgn3文本审核apihttps://ai.baidu.com/ai-doc/ANTIPORN/Vk3h6xaga//响应参数说明以及错误码信息微信公众平台配置request合法域名aip.baidubce.com发起请求uni.request({//获取access_tokenurl:'
ShinyRuo_
·
2020-06-22 05:10
非确定型有限自动机变换为确定型有限自动机
3.构造出正规式的状态转换矩阵然后把NFA转化为
DFA
(确定性有限自动机)。如:正规式(a|c)*ac语法树:M(R3)、由图可知最底层是ab我们可以很容易得到:注:So为初态
It界搬运工
·
2020-06-22 01:26
编译原理
正则表达式与
DFA
、NFA
而有穷状态自动机又可以分为确定的(
DFA
)、不确定的(NFA)确定的有穷自动机就是说当一个状态面对一个输入符号的时候,它所转换到的是一个唯一确定的状态;不确定的有穷自动机是说当一个状态面对一个输入
MOKE_XR
·
2020-06-22 01:26
总结和问题
下载镜像docker pull时报错:unauthorized: authentication required
具体报错过程:[root@vl-bg-anaylsis02~]#dockerpullmysql/mysql-server:5.75.7:Pullingfrommysql/mysql-serverc7127
dfa
6d78
老虎大人
·
2020-06-21 21:02
运维
Docker
编译原理中的正则表达式、NFA和
DFA
这点知识,貌似也是编译原理课程的一个考点…………(直接从正则表达式构造
DFA
的http://blog.csdn.net/betabin/article/details/8082866)正则表达式,接触得已经不少
BetaBin
·
2020-06-21 17:49
编译原理
正则表达式
语言
算法
transition
function
input
从0到1打造正则表达式执行引擎(一)
\d\s……)子表达式(正则表达式())练习题代码实现建图匹配下集预告功能完善化
DFA
引擎正则引擎优化今天是五一假期第一天,这里先给大家拜个晚咳咳!!祝大家五一快乐,我这里给大家奉上一篇硬核教程。
xindoo
·
2020-06-21 14:44
编译原理
算法
有限自动机
有限自动机
DFA
(确定有限自动机)一个确定有限自动机M是一个5元组M={S,∑,f,S0,Z}S:是一个有限状态集,它的每一个元素称为一个状态;∑:是一个有穷字母表,它的每一个元素称为一个输入符号;f:
桀骜浮沉
·
2020-06-21 13:16
#
编译原理
5分钟搞定
敏感词过滤
!
函数工作流(FunctionGraph,FGS)是一项基于事件驱动的函数托管计算服务,托管函数具备以毫秒级弹性伸缩、免运维、高可靠的方式运行。通过函数工作流,开发者无需配置和管理服务器,只需关注业务逻辑,编写函数代码,以无服务器的方式构建应用,便能开发出一个弹性高可用的后端系统,并按实际运行消耗的资源计费。极大地提高了开发和运维效率,减小了运作成本。相比于传统的架构,函数服务构建的无服务器架构具有
PaaS小魔仙
·
2020-06-21 12:33
个人分享
云函数
函数服务
无服务器框架
函数工作流
敏感词过滤
正则表达式里的底层原理是什么
正则表达式里的底层原理是什么一、总结一句话总结:简单地说,实现正则表达式引擎的有两种方式:
DFA
自动机(DeterministicFinalAutomata确定型有穷自动机)和NFA自动机(NondeterministicFiniteAutomaton
weixin_34075551
·
2020-06-21 11:29
实现一个正则表达式引擎in Python(三)
项目地址:RegexinPython前两篇已经完成的写了一个基于NFA的正则表达式引擎了,下面要做的就是更近一步,把NFA转换为
DFA
,并对
DFA
最小化
DFA
的定义对于NFA转换为
DFA
的算法,主要就是将
Claire_ljy
·
2020-06-21 09:56
【面试被虐】说说游戏中的
敏感词过滤
是如何实现的?
小秋今天去面试了,面试官问了一个与
敏感词过滤
算法相关的问题,然而小秋对
敏感词过滤
算法一点也没听说过。于是,有了下下事情的发生.....面试官开怼面试官:玩过王者荣耀吧?了解过
敏感词过滤
吗?
weixin_30339969
·
2020-06-21 09:24
从NFA到
DFA
emptyset∅B∅\emptyset∅{B,C}∅\emptyset∅C∅\emptyset∅∅\emptyset∅{C,D}D∅\emptyset∅∅\emptyset∅∅\emptyset∅如果转成
DFA
Meskjei
·
2020-06-21 01:06
编译原理
形式语言与编译六
DFA
的最小化
DFA
的最小化前面我们讲过NFA通过确定化能够得到
DFA
,现在我们看能不能让已经得到的
DFA
的状态数能不能再继续变小(minimise).其实也就是对优化再优化。
_Sandman
·
2020-06-18 18:00
形式语言与编译五 正则语言的三个性质
非正则语言NFA、\(\varepsilon-NFA\)面向人构造系统
DFA
面向机器构造系统自动机理论非常完美!!
_Sandman
·
2020-06-17 21:00
形式语言与编译4 NFA与正则表达式的相互转化
正则表达式和正则语言
DFA
、NFA、\(\varepsilon\)-NFA隐含的处理的语言就是,正则语言。有的人知道自动机,有的人不知道自动机。
_Sandman
·
2020-06-17 16:00
形式语言与编译(三)NFA 、e-NFA to
DFA
DFA
、NFA、\(\varepsilon-NFA\)的等价性这三种自动机定义的语言是同一种语言,都是正规语言
DFA
定义的语言可以被NFA接受;NFA定义的语言可以被
DFA
接受每一个NFA都能转化为等价的
_Sandman
·
2020-06-16 18:00
形式语言与编译(二)NFA
正则语言如果某个语言能被
DFA
识别,那么它就是正则的例题1:构造一个字母表为{0,1}的
DFA
,使其接受所有最多含有三个1的串。
_Sandman
·
2020-06-15 16:00
形式语言与编译
DFA
形式语言与自动机期末考试复习,太难了,感觉写出来会好点有穷自动机(有限自动机FiniteAutometa)自动机通常用状态转移图来表示。从一个状态输入一个刺激得到另一个状态的过程。软件工程里面的实时系统、复杂系统也用状态转移图来表示,因此状态转移图非常有用。通过状态转移图,可以明确的描述某个系统有穷自动机表示状态转移:上图有13个状态转移函数,也就是有13个转移状态机的应用:TCP发送数据协议用状
_Sandman
·
2020-06-14 17:00
深入正则表达式(3):正则表达式工作引擎流程分析与原理释义
有兴趣可以回顾《深入正则表达式(0):正则表达式概述》正则引擎类型正则引擎主要可以分为两大类:一种是
DFA
(DeterministicFiniteAutomatons/确定性有限自动机
zhoulujun
·
2020-06-06 23:00
深入正则表达式(3):正则表达式工作引擎流程分析与原理释义
有兴趣可以回顾《深入正则表达式(0):正则表达式概述》正则引擎类型正则引擎主要可以分为两大类:一种是
DFA
(DeterministicFiniteAutomatons/确定性有限自动机
周陆军
·
2020-06-06 23:31
正则引擎
NFA
DFA
From
DFA
to KMP algorithm
FromDFAtoKMPalgorithmDFAInthetheoryofcomputation,abranchoftheoreticalcomputerscience,adeterministicfiniteautomaton(
DFA
陈鬼尘
·
2020-06-05 14:00
访香港翡翠创作双年赛冠军邝美贞
她不仅是“构思玉中有话”的首饰设计师,曾获得
DFA
亚洲最具影响力设计奖,也是香港学术评审局之珠宝
中国宝石杂志
·
2020-05-18 00:00
KMP 算法的两种实现
前言朴素子字符串查找算法KMP算法的基本思想基于
DFA
的KMP实现基于PMT的KMP实现历史渊源&
DFA
&PMT结语参考链接前言KMP算法在LeetCode刷题的过程中看见过好几次,这几天终于去学习了一下
rgb-24bit
·
2020-05-10 16:00
从0到1打造正则表达式执行引擎
\d\s……)子表达式(正则表达式())练习题代码实现建图匹配下集预告功能完善化
DFA
引擎正则引擎优化今天是五一假期第一天,这里先给大家拜个晚咳咳!!祝大家五一快乐,我这里给大家奉上一篇硬核教程。
xindoo
·
2020-05-04 10:00
自己实现一个
DFA
串模式识别器(一)
自己实现一个
DFA
串模式识别器前言 这是我编译原理课程的实验。执行效果:输入一个正规表达式:(s.f.l*.e)|(a*.b*)输入:“sfe”输出:matched!
Skipper-
·
2020-04-18 15:00
web系统安全运营之基础- 基于
DFA
算法的高性能的敏感词,脏词的检测过滤算法类(c#).
【概述】做好一个web系统的安全运维,除了常规的防注入,防入侵等,还有一个检测并过滤敏感词,脏词..这件事做得不好,轻则导致一场投诉或纠纷,重则导致产品被勒令关闭停运。废话少说,先看下代码,可以拿过去直接使用。1usingMicrosoft.VisualBasic;2usingSystem;3usingSystem.Collections.Generic;4usingSystem.IO;5usin
黄岛主
·
2020-04-15 20:00
孕期婆婆不让产检,谁能想到宝宝的脚能变成这样子
17f300020870eb931
dfa
这让长老太惊得差点没把孩子给掉地上去,张护士问这是不是抱错孩子了?在确认无误了,不顾媳
木子李公社
·
2020-04-14 07:19
动态规划——最大子串和
在学生年代的时候,有一段时间爱好刷水题,还狂言说每天要刷一道,但是技术不精,遇到困难就退缩了,后来有一次去腾讯面试的时候问到
敏感词过滤
算法怎么实现,当然了,今天要说的不是这个,这个太难了,就是我参加工作有大半年了
黑白咖
·
2020-04-13 10:41
词法分析器---自动生成器
词法分析器的自动生成器的作用:只需输入合法词的正则表达式,就可以输出一个确定有限状态自动机(
DFA
),而
DFA
的表现形式,往往是一张分析表。
拉丁吴
·
2020-04-13 09:13
和弗兰克学写作第八期+热文中给予有缘人点滴灵感的好文+2/6
一、《我也是三本院校毕业,但我想以过来人的身份你告诉这些》—左小夏文章:www.jianshu.com/p/af2cb2
dfa
0b3我喜欢:作者通过自己的高考失利后的日子,来告诉那些在高考考试中未达成自己志愿
温妮Zhou
·
2020-04-13 07:00
UITextField字数限制
感谢http://www.jianshu.com/p/2d1c06f2
dfa
4定义一个宏,根据设计师要求确定限制多少字符#defineMAX_STARWORDS_LENGTH5添加监听事件[_textFieldaddTarget
NateLam
·
2020-04-10 10:30
从正则表达式(RE)到最小确定性有限状态自动机(
DFA
)
RE(RegularExpression)到最小
DFA
(DeterministicFiniteAutomaton)的转换是构建正则表达式引擎的基础,并且也是构建词法分析器的基础.RERE描述了一个定义在某个字母表
红绡枫叶
·
2020-04-08 05:24
编译原理系列之三 词法分析
词法分析NFA与
DFA
的等价性:对于每个NFAM′都一定存在一个DFAM,使L(M′)=L(M)。
getianao
·
2020-04-08 02:23
BZOJ-2540 循环格
代码:03087bf40ad162d97d92c31813
dfa
9ec8a13cdb2.jpg.png#include#include#includeusingnamespacestd;#defineMAXN1
AmadeusChan
·
2020-04-07 04:35
上一页
14
15
16
17
18
19
20
21
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他